[Rpm-maint] [rpm-software-management/rpm] Check not configured keystore backends for keys (PR #3539)
Florian Festi
notifications at github.com
Sat Jan 25 10:59:27 UTC 2025
Give an warning if they contain public keys. This allows the user to
detect misconfigurations or missing conversion from one backend to
another.
The warning will need adjusting to point the user to the rebuild functionality to do the actual fixing. But this should be done in the PR adding that.
The test case needs to be adjusted as part of #3535 or after it being merged.
Split out of #3474
You can view, comment on, or merge this pull request online at:
https://github.com/rpm-software-management/rpm/pull/3539
-- Commit Summary --
* Add rpmKeyringSize()
* Add names as string to the keystore classes
* Check not configured keystore backends for keys
-- File Changes --
M include/rpm/rpmkeyring.h (8)
M lib/keystore.cc (21)
M lib/keystore.hh (9)
M lib/rpmts.cc (1)
M rpmio/rpmkeyring.cc (14)
M tests/rpmsigdig.at (26)
-- Patch Links --
https://github.com/rpm-software-management/rpm/pull/3539.patch
https://github.com/rpm-software-management/rpm/pull/3539.diff
--
Reply to this email directly or view it on GitHub:
https://github.com/rpm-software-management/rpm/pull/3539
You are receiving this because you are subscribed to this thread.
Message ID: <rpm-software-management/rpm/pull/3539 at github.com>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.rpm.org/pipermail/rpm-maint/attachments/20250125/236ea36b/attachment.htm>
More information about the Rpm-maint
mailing list